标题:用二进制给密码加密
只看楼主
fanglinzhi
Rank: 1
等 级:新手上路
帖 子:4
专家分:0
注 册:2004-6-21
 问题点数:0 回复次数:1 
用二进制给密码加密

<html> <head> <meta http-equiv="Content-Type" content="text/html; charset=gb2312"> <title>无标题文档</title> <script language=vbscript> Function str2bin(varstr) str2bin="" For i=1 To Len(varstr) varchar=mid(varstr,i,1) varasc = Asc(varchar) If varasc<0 Then varasc = varasc + 65535 End If If varasc > 255 Then varlow = Left(Hex(Asc(varchar)),2) varhigh = right(Hex(Asc(varchar)),2) str2bin = str2bin & chrB("&H" & varlow) & chrB("&H" & varhigh) Else str2bin = str2bin & chrB(AscB(varchar)) End If Next End Function sub checkuser() a=document.form1.pass.value document.form1.pass.value=str2bin(a) msgbox(a) form1.submit end sub </script> </head> <body> <form name="form1" method="post" action="4.asp"> <table width="90%" border="0" cellspacing="0" cellpadding="0"> <tr> <td><input name="username" type="text" id="username"> </td> </tr> <tr> <td><input name="pass" type="password" id="pass"> <input name="text1" type="text" id="text1"></td> </tr> <tr> <td><input type="submit" name="Submit" value="提交" onClick="checkuser()"> </td> </tr> <tr> <td>&nbsp;</td> </tr> </table> </form> </body> </html>

如果大家有更好的加密方法,请回复一下,上继方法,最好配和网页加密一起使用,己取得更好的效果,由于编写匆忙,偌有什么不足之处,请大家给予指点。

搜索更多相关主题的帖子: 二进制 密码 
2004-06-21 14:34
hu_sir
Rank: 1
等 级:新手上路
帖 子:208
专家分:0
注 册:2004-4-29
得分:0 
发错地方了
2004-06-21 16:52



参与讨论请移步原网站贴子:https://bbs.bccn.net/thread-2729-1-1.html




关于我们 | 广告合作 | 编程中国 | 清除Cookies | TOP | 手机版

编程中国 版权所有,并保留所有权利。
Powered by Discuz, Processed in 0.232382 second(s), 8 queries.
Copyright©2004-2024, BCCN.NET, All Rights Reserved